Butter Cookie Dough Peach Cobbler

Ingredients

Dough:
  • 1/2 cup all purpose flour
  • 1/4 tsp. baking powder
  • pinch salt
  • 8 Tbsp. unsalted butter; softened
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1/2 large egg; or one yolk
  • 1/4 tsp. vanilla extract
Fruit Filling:
  • 1-3/4 lbs peaches; peeled, pitted and sliced
  • 2 tsp. corn starch
  • 1/3 - 1/3 cup sugar
  • 1 tsp. vanilla extract; optional
  • pinch cloves; optional

Directions

Dough:

Mix flour, baking powder and salt in small bowl and set aside. Beat butter and sugar until well blended. Beat in egg and vanilla. Add flour mixture; stir until just combined.

Fruit Filling:

Toss to coat peaches, cornstarch, sugar, and any optional ingredient. Drop dough onto prepared fruit by heaping tablespoons. Bake at 375 degrees F for 45-55 minutes.

This recipe is for a 8 inch square or 9 inch round baking pan. May easily be doubled for a 13x9 inch pan.
